Arrow Senior Living is a reputable organization that manages a diverse collection of senior living communities across multiple states, including Missouri, Iowa, Illinois, Ohio, and Indiana. Currently, Arrow Senior Living operates 25 properties and employs nearly 1,400 dedicated professionals committed to enhancing the lives of seniors. The company offers varying levels of care, ranging from independent living to assisted living and memory care, providing a comprehensive and compassionate approach to senior housing.
